I have a tracking SS im working on.

A1 is a drop down and is used to show either "open" (yellow) or "closed" (black). A2 is a days counter.

is there a way to set the columns so that when "closed" is selected, the cell next to it (i.e A2) turns black?

Basically i just want to be able to select closed on the drop down and then as a result both the closed box and the cell next to it both turn black.

is there a way to do that?

Hi,

Use this formula in A2 for CF format Black:

=A1="closed"
